CSIR NAL Apprentice Trainee Recruitment 2026

CSIR National Aerospace Laboratories (CSIR-NAL) has released a notification for the recruitment of 35 Apprentice Trainee posts. This is a walk-in interview process, and no online application is required. Candidates holding ITI certificates in relevant trades are eligible to attend the walk-in interview scheduled for 04th and 05th February 2026.

Vacancy Details

Post Name (Trade) No. of Posts Salary (Stipend)
Fitter 10 Rs. 10,560/-
Electrician 07 Rs. 10,560/-
Machinist 05 Rs. 10,560/-
Turner 06 Rs. 10,560/-
Mechanic Motor Vehicle (MMV) 02 Rs. 10,560/-
Draughtsman Mechanical 03 Rs. 10,560/-
Welder (Gas & Electric) 02 Rs. 9,600/-
Total 35 -

Eligibility Criteria

Eligibility for Apprentice Trainee (All Trades)

  • Essential Qualification: ITI passed in the following trades only: Fitter, Electrician, Machinist, Turner, Mechanic Motor Vehicle (MMV), Draughtsman Mechanical, Welder (Gas & Electric).
  • Experience: Not specified.
  • Important Instructions:
    • Candidates appearing for Walk-in-interview for apprenticeship trainee in trades other than the above mentioned will not be entertained.
    • Final year students and those awaiting results are NOT ELIGIBLE.
    • Candidates already undergoing or undergone Apprenticeship Training are not permitted.
    • Candidates must register on the apprenticeship web portal (https://www.apprenticeshipindia.gov.in/) before attending.
    • Candidates must possess original certificates including SSLC, ITI, Character, Conduct, and Nativity certificate.

Selection Process

  • Selection will be based on the Walk-in-Interview and document verification.
  • Reporting Time for Registration: 08:30 AM to 09:30 AM.
  • Venue: RAB Meeting Complex, CSIR-NAL, Bengaluru.

How to Apply

  • This is a Walk-in-Interview process. No online application is required.
  • Candidates must register on the apprenticeship portal: https://www.apprenticeshipindia.gov.in/.
  • Download and fill the application form from the official website.
  • Attend the interview with all required documents at the specified venue.

FAQs

Q1: Is there an application fee for CSIR NAL Recruitment 2026?
A: No, there is no application fee.

Q2: What is the age limit?
A: The age should be between 18 to 35 years as of the date of interview.

Q3: What is the duration of the training?
A: The training period is one year from the date of joining.

Q4: Is accommodation provided?
A: No, CSIR-NAL will not provide accommodation to the apprentice trainee.

About National Aerospace Laboratories

National Aerospace Laboratories Logo

National Aerospace Laboratories (NAL) is a premier research institution under the Council of Scientific and Industrial Research (CSIR) in India. Established in 1959, NAL is dedicated to the advancement of aerospace science and technology. Its headquarters is located in Bengaluru, Karnataka.

NAL's primary focus is on aerospace research, development, and technology demonstration. The institution plays a vital role in the design, development, and testing of various aerospace systems and components. Its diverse areas of expertise include aerodynamics, structural mechanics, propulsion, flight mechanics, avionics, materials science, and aerospace systems engineering.

NAL is involved in the development of both civil and military aerospace technologies. It collaborates with various national and international organizations, including government agencies, academic institutions, and industry partners, to carry out cutting-edge research and development projects. The institution strives to address the challenges faced by the aerospace industry and contribute to the growth and self-reliance of the Indian aerospace sector.
